Over the last decade, several high-profile "honey trap" scandals involving government officials and defense personnel have come to light. These often involve the use of recorded video calls (a modern evolution of the MMS) to blackmail individuals for sensitive information, highlighting the national security risks associated with digital privacy breaches. 5. Following broader national conversations on safety and consent, laws against voyeurism ( Section 354C of the Indian Penal Code/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ita ) were codified, explicitly criminalizing the act of watching or capturing images of a woman engaging in a private act without her consent. However, the law has struggled to keep pace with rapidly evolving technology and the scale of the problem. Law enforcement is often in a "cat-and-mouse game" with perpetrators, who use encrypted apps and social media bots to rapidly spread content before it can be taken down.
